機(jī)器視覺(jué)是一門涉及多個(gè)領(lǐng)域的綜合性技術(shù),它利用機(jī)器代替人眼進(jìn)行測(cè)量和判斷。以下是一些入門教程和需要學(xué)習(xí)的知識(shí)點(diǎn):

1. 基礎(chǔ)知識(shí)

圖像處理:了解圖像處理的基本概念,如圖像增強(qiáng)、圖像匹配、圖像分割、圖像分類和圖像識(shí)別。

模式識(shí)別:學(xué)習(xí)模式識(shí)別的基本原理和技術(shù),包括特征提取、分類器設(shè)計(jì)等。

計(jì)算機(jī)視覺(jué):理解計(jì)算機(jī)視覺(jué)的核心概念,如圖像表示、特征檢測(cè)、目標(biāo)跟蹤等。

機(jī)器視覺(jué)教程入門,機(jī)器視覺(jué)需要學(xué)什么

機(jī)器學(xué)習(xí):掌握機(jī)器學(xué)習(xí)的基礎(chǔ)知識(shí),特別是監(jiān)督學(xué)習(xí)和非監(jiān)督學(xué)習(xí)方法。

2. 編程語(yǔ)言

Python:Python 是機(jī)器視覺(jué)中最常用的編程語(yǔ)言之一,因?yàn)樗胸S富的庫(kù)支持,如 OpenCV、TensorFlow 和 PyTorch。

C/C++:對(duì)于高性能的應(yīng)用,C/C++ 也是重要的編程語(yǔ)言,特別是在嵌入式系統(tǒng)中。

3. 框架和庫(kù)

OpenCV:OpenCV 是一個(gè)開源的計(jì)算機(jī)視覺(jué)庫(kù),提供了大量的圖像處理和計(jì)算機(jī)視覺(jué)功能。

TensorFlow:TensorFlow 是一個(gè)強(qiáng)大的機(jī)器學(xué)習(xí)框架,支持深度學(xué)習(xí)模型的構(gòu)建和訓(xùn)練。

PyTorch:PyTorch 是另一個(gè)流行的深度學(xué)習(xí)框架,以其靈活性和動(dòng)態(tài)計(jì)算圖著稱。

Halcon:Halcon 是一個(gè)商業(yè)的機(jī)器視覺(jué)庫(kù),提供了豐富的圖像處理和分析功能。

4. 實(shí)踐項(xiàng)目

圖像分類:通過(guò)實(shí)際項(xiàng)目學(xué)習(xí)如何對(duì)圖像進(jìn)行分類。

目標(biāo)檢測(cè):實(shí)現(xiàn)一個(gè)目標(biāo)檢測(cè)系統(tǒng),能夠識(shí)別和定位圖像中的特定對(duì)象。

人臉識(shí)別:開發(fā)一個(gè)人臉識(shí)別系統(tǒng),能夠識(shí)別人臉并進(jìn)行身份驗(yàn)證。

光學(xué)字符識(shí)別 (OCR):實(shí)現(xiàn)一個(gè) OCR 系統(tǒng),能夠讀取和識(shí)別圖像中的文字。

5. 參加培訓(xùn)班或課程

在線課程:許多在線平臺(tái)如 Coursera、Udacity 和 edX 提供了豐富的機(jī)器視覺(jué)和計(jì)算機(jī)視覺(jué)課程。

培訓(xùn)班:參加專業(yè)的培訓(xùn)班,可以獲得更系統(tǒng)的學(xué)習(xí)和實(shí)踐機(jī)會(huì)。

6. 學(xué)術(shù)論文閱讀

最新技術(shù):閱讀機(jī)器視覺(jué)領(lǐng)域的學(xué)術(shù)論文,了解最新的技術(shù)發(fā)展和研究方向。

經(jīng)典論文:學(xué)習(xí)經(jīng)典的機(jī)器視覺(jué)論文,理解基本原理和方法。

機(jī)器視覺(jué)需要學(xué)什么

1. 基礎(chǔ)知識(shí)

圖像處理:學(xué)習(xí)圖像處理的基本概念和技術(shù),如濾波、邊緣檢測(cè)、閾值分割等。

模式識(shí)別:理解模式識(shí)別的基本原理,包括特征提取、分類器設(shè)計(jì)等。

計(jì)算機(jī)視覺(jué):掌握計(jì)算機(jī)視覺(jué)的核心概念,如圖像表示、特征檢測(cè)、目標(biāo)跟蹤等。

機(jī)器學(xué)習(xí):學(xué)習(xí)機(jī)器學(xué)習(xí)的基礎(chǔ)知識(shí),特別是監(jiān)督學(xué)習(xí)和非監(jiān)督學(xué)習(xí)方法。

2. 編程語(yǔ)言

Python:Python 是機(jī)器視覺(jué)中最常用的編程語(yǔ)言之一,因?yàn)樗胸S富的庫(kù)支持,如 OpenCV、TensorFlow 和 PyTorch。

C/C++:對(duì)于高性能的應(yīng)用,C/C++ 也是重要的編程語(yǔ)言,特別是在嵌入式系統(tǒng)中。

3. 框架和庫(kù)

OpenCV:OpenCV 是一個(gè)開源的計(jì)算機(jī)視覺(jué)庫(kù),提供了大量的圖像處理和計(jì)算機(jī)視覺(jué)功能。

TensorFlow:TensorFlow 是一個(gè)強(qiáng)大的機(jī)器學(xué)習(xí)框架,支持深度學(xué)習(xí)模型的構(gòu)建和訓(xùn)練。

PyTorch:PyTorch 是另一個(gè)流行的深度學(xué)習(xí)框架,以其靈活性和動(dòng)態(tài)計(jì)算圖著稱。

Halcon:Halcon 是一個(gè)商業(yè)的機(jī)器視覺(jué)庫(kù),提供了豐富的圖像處理和分析功能。

4. 硬件知識(shí)

相機(jī):了解不同類型的相機(jī)(如 CCD 相機(jī)和 CMOS 相機(jī)),以及如何選擇合適的相機(jī)。

鏡頭:學(xué)習(xí)鏡頭的基本原理和選項(xiàng),如定焦鏡頭、變倍鏡頭、遠(yuǎn)心鏡頭等。

光源:理解不同光源的特點(diǎn)和應(yīng)用,如 LED 光源、激光光源等。

5. 系統(tǒng)集成

圖像處理單元:了解圖像處理單元的工作原理,如圖像捕獲卡和圖像處理軟件。

通訊/輸入輸出單元:學(xué)習(xí)如何實(shí)現(xiàn)系統(tǒng)之間的通訊和數(shù)據(jù)傳輸。

6. 算法

基礎(chǔ)算法:掌握?qǐng)D像增強(qiáng)、圖像匹配、圖像分割、圖像分類和圖像識(shí)別等基礎(chǔ)算法。

機(jī)器學(xué)習(xí)算法:學(xué)習(xí)傳統(tǒng)的機(jī)器學(xué)習(xí)算法,如決策樹、聚類、貝葉斯分類、支持向量機(jī)、EM、Adaboost 等。

深度學(xué)習(xí)算法:了解深度學(xué)習(xí)處理圖像特征的方法,如卷積神經(jīng)網(wǎng)絡(luò)(CNN)、循環(huán)神經(jīng)網(wǎng)絡(luò)(RNN)等。

通過(guò)以上步驟和知識(shí)點(diǎn)的學(xué)習(xí),你可以逐步掌握機(jī)器視覺(jué)的基本原理和應(yīng)用,為今后的深入研究和實(shí)際項(xiàng)目打下堅(jiān)實(shí)的基礎(chǔ)。